WebSep 22, 2024 · Iran has a history of restricting Internet connectivity in response to protests, taking such steps in May 2024, February 2024, and November 2024. They have taken a similar approach to the current protests, including disrupting Internet connectivity, blocking social media platforms, and blocking DNS.
